ChemicalBurn is a free, attractive screensaver that simulates a data transportation network with a colorful, fast-moving array of "self-organizing" nodes and packages. You don't need any special knowledge to enjoy this screensaver's ever-changing, high-tech display, but networking enthusiasts will appreciate the simulation's veracity (as packages attempt to find the fastest way to their destination) and they'll love tinkering with detailed settings, including control over traffic and distance weighting (for example, as linear, square, log, and exponential functions). ChemicalBurn's calculations can be CPU-intensive--proportional to the cube of the number of nodes selected--so casual users should read the app's documentation before changing too many settings.

Watch packages fly by with this screensaver that simulates a self-organizing transportation network.
ChemicalBurn is a screensaver that simulates a self-organizing transportation network. Watch as packages fly around your screen, routes are formed, and the network heals itself after an outage, all smoothly animated in OpenGL.
